Singapore vs Nioro Climate & Distance Between

Mali flag
  • The distance between Singapore, Singapore and Nioro, Mali is approximately 12,462 km or 7,744 mi.
  • To reach Singapore in this distance one would set out from Nioro bearing 82.1°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Singapore bearing 107.1° or ESE .
  • Singapore has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Nioro has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
  • Singapore is in or near the tropical moist forest biome whereas Nioro is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ome.
  • The average temperature is 1.6 °C (2.9°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.5 °C (17.1°F) less in Singapore.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1692 mm (66.6 in) more which is equivalent to 1692 l/m² (41.53 US gal/ft²) or 16,920,000 l/ha (1,808,860 US gal/ac) more. About 4 2/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3° higher in Singapore than in Nioro.
